Abstract
The language problem has always been serious in Ukraine 
and often turned into an armed confrontation. This problem is 
becoming particularly acute in view of the invasion of Ukraine by 
the Russian Federation, one of the stated reasons for the «linguistic 
inequality». The aim of the article is to determine the impact of 
unregulated political lobbying by individuals or groups on the aggravation 
of language conicts in Ukraine and compare it with other countries. The 
research involved the following methods: analysis and synthesis, statistical 
analysis,  graphical  methods,  establishment  of  cause-eect  relations  and 
cluster analysis. The novelty of the research is the study of the impact of 
political lobbying on the development of language conicts in the region by 
means of cluster analysis. The study established the relationship between 
legislative regulation of lobbying, language conicts and corruption rates in 
the country. In the conclusions, the analysis shows that the availability of 
the institution of lobbying corresponds to lower rates of corruption and the 
virtual absence of language conicts. The obtained results can be used by 
the government to improve Ukrainian legislation.
